Compliance with EBA Guidelines on the supervision of the threshold and other procedural aspects concerning the establishment of intermediate parent companies (EBA/GL/2021/08)

The French Prudential Supervision and Resolution Authority (ACPR) has formally declared compliance with European Banking Authority Guidelines EBA/GL/2021/08 concerning threshold supervision and procedural requirements for establishing intermediate parent companies in the Union. These guidelines take effect on 31 December 2021 and apply to ACPR-supervised branches and subsidiaries of third-country groups, encompassing financial holding companies, mixed financial holding companies, investment holding companies, credit institutions, and investment firms. All covered entities must implement all necessary measures to ensure full compliance with these requirements in accordance with Article 16 of Regulation (EU) No 1093/2010.

NOTICE Compliance with the European Banking Authority Guidelines EBA/GL/2021/08 on the supervision of the threshold and other procedural aspects concerning the establishment of intermediate parent companies in the Union

The Prudential Supervision and Resolution Authority (ACPR) hereby declares compliance with the European Banking Authority Guidelines (EBA/GL/2021/08) on the supervision of the threshold and other procedural aspects concerning the establishment of intermediate parent companies in the Union in this notice.

These Guidelines apply from 31 December 2021 to branches and subsidiaries of third-country groups established in the Union subject to ACPR supervision, whether they take the form of financial holding companies, mixed financial holding companies, investment holding companies, credit institutions or investment firms. They must take all necessary measures to comply with them, in accordance with Article 16 of Regulation (EU) No 1093/2010 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 24 November 2010 establishing a European Supervisory Authority (European Banking Authority).
